September 2025 is a total lunar eclipse which occurs only when the Earth perfectly aligns between the sun and the moon. This allows to cast its central shadow also known as umbra across the lunar surface. As a result, the moon glows in shades of red and orange as sunlight bends through Earth's atmosphere, filtering out blue wavelengths.
Chandra Grahan 2025: Date and timings
The total lunar eclipse happening on 7 September 2025 will be visible for several hours this time. Skywatchers and astronomers will have ample amount of time to enjoy the spectacular celestial event. The highlight of the event is its totality, when the moon is visible as a glowing red orb will last for 82 minutes. This span of visibility is very rare and one of the longest total lunar eclipses in the recent memory. Check below for exact timings so that you do not miss out!
| Eclipse Phase | UTC Timings | IST Timings |
|---|---|---|
| Penumbral Eclipse begins | 15:42 UTC | 9:12 PM IST |
| Partial eclipse begins | 16:39 UTC | 10:09 PM IST |
| Total eclipse begins (blood moon) | 17:31 UTC | 11:01 PM IST |
| Maximum eclipse | 18:11 UTC | 11:41 PM IST |
| Total eclipse ends | 18:52 UTC | 12:22 AM IST (September 8) |
| Partial Eclipse ends | 19:44 UTC | 1:14 AM IST |
| Penumbral eclipse ends | 20:41 UTC | 2:11 AM IST |

The lunar eclipse 2025 is taking place during Pitru Paksha, a time for ancestor worship. During this period, people conduct Shradh and puja at their homes to attain the blessings from their ancestors.
Sutak Kaal is the inauspicious time period observed before and during an eclipse. Indians believe that the sutak kaal starts before 9 hours before the lunar eclipse. During sutak kaal, it is believed not to drink, eat, cook, or start anything auspicious. Spiritual books, religious gurus, and astrologers strongly suggest to perform all the significant rituals before the sutak kaal starts.
